Question about Xbox controller

My PC and TV are about 5 meters apart, and I want to buy an Xbox controller to play wirelessly. I heard there's an adapter called the Xbox Wireless Adapter for Windows that lets me play wirelessly over this distance. I will be using the controller mainly for Steam and emulators."

If your controller is for the Xbox One S, X, or Series S/X then it has bluetooth built in and the wireless adapter isnt needed, and for Series S/X controllers at least if you double press the sync button itll switch between the Xbox and the last device you connected to via bluetooth

Unfortunately the official Xbox Wireless Adapter isn't manufactured any longer. You can use Bluetooth, but it has a lot more latency that the wifi direct based Xbox wireless stack. This adapter will give the best possible Bluetooth connection https://www.gulikit.com/productinfo/3695391.html
